Patch: No mapping of virtual COM ports to infrared ports
This update resolves the "Malformed Data Frame Sent to a Windows 2000 Computer Through an Infrared Port Causes Stop Error" security vulnerability in Windows 2000, and is discussed in Microsoft Security Bulletin MS01-046.
